Where in London is a decent place to live for a foreigner aiming to work and live in London for 6mos-2 years?We Answered:
You should focus more on areas in the west/southwest side of London, this way you can get more areas you like. There are some areas in the east side but the good ones are more spotty. Perhaps the best way to do it, is to move here and get a place where you can stay weekly or very short term, so you can get more time to explore and decide which areas you like better.The best websites to find properties are.....
